来源:煤矿手游网 更新:2023-12-13 07:02:05
用手机看
Vue的生命周期是指Vue实例从创建到销毁的整个过程,包括了一系列的生命周期钩子函数。通过这些钩子函数,我们可以在不同阶段执行相应的操作,实现对Vue实例的精细控制。
1.创建阶段:
在创建阶段,Vue实例会经历以下几个生命周期钩子函数:
- beforeCreate:在实例初始化之后,数据观测和事件配置之前被调用。此时,组件的数据、计算属性和方法还未初始化。
- created:在实例创建完成后被调用。此时,组件已经完成了数据观测、属性和方法的运算,但尚未挂载到DOM上。
2.挂载阶段:
在挂载阶段,Vue实例会经历以下几个生命周期钩子函数:
- beforeMount:在挂载开始之前被调用。此时,模板编译已完成,但尚未将模板渲染成真实的DOM。
- mounted:在挂载完成后被调用。此时,Vue实例已经将模板渲染成真实的DOM,并且可以通过DOM API进行操作。
3.更新阶段:
在更新阶段,Vue实例会经历以下几个生命周期钩子函数:
- beforeUpdate:在数据更新之前被调用。此时,数据已经被改变,但DOM尚未重新渲染。
- updated:在数据更新之后被调用。此时,Vue实例的数据和DOM都已经更新完毕。
4.销毁阶段:
在销毁阶段,Vue实例会经历以下生命周期钩子函数:
tokenpocket钱包:https://dzyjj.net/danji/20008.html